US Varicocele treatment Market Summary

As per Market Research Future analysis, the US varicocele treatment market size was estimated at 66.0 USD Million in 2024. The US varicocele treatment market is projected to grow from 68.45 USD Million in 2025 to 98.5 USD Million by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 3.7%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035

Rising Incidence of Varicocele Diagnoses

The rising incidence of varicocele diagnoses is a critical driver for the varicocele treatment market. Studies indicate that varicocele affects about 15% of the male population, with higher rates observed in men seeking fertility treatment. This increasing prevalence is prompting more men to seek medical advice and treatment options. As awareness grows and diagnostic techniques improve, more cases are being identified, leading to a higher demand for treatment solutions. The varicocele treatment market is thus positioned for growth, as healthcare providers respond to the increasing need for effective treatment options to address this common condition.

By Procedure Type: Varicocelectomy (Largest) vs. Embolization (Fastest-Growing)

The US varicocele treatment market is characterized by three primary procedure types: varicocelectomy, embolization, and sclerotherapy. Among these, varicocelectomy holds the largest market share, being the traditional and most widely accepted surgical procedure for varicocele repair. Embolization has emerged as a popular alternative due to its minimally invasive nature, contributing to its rapid growth in recent years while sclerotherapy remains a less common option for treatment. Recent trends indicate a shift towards less invasive procedures, with embolization leading the charge as the fastest-growing segment. Factors contributing to this growth include increased patient awareness, technological advancements, and a higher preference for outpatient treatment options. Moreover, the aging male population and rising rates of infertility issues are also driving the demand for effective varicocele treatments, positioning embolization favorably in the evolving market landscape.

Varicocelectomy (Dominant) vs. Embolization (Emerging)

Varicocelectomy is recognized as the dominant procedure in the US varicocele treatment market, known for its effectiveness in treating varicocele through surgical intervention that involves ligation of the affected veins. Its long-standing reputation and established results make it the go-to choice for many practitioners and patients alike. On the other hand, embolization represents an emerging option, leveraging innovative techniques to occlude the problematic veins using a catheter, resulting in reduced recovery times and minimal invasiveness. This trend towards embolization showcases the market's evolving preferences, with patients increasingly opting for solutions that align with modern healthcare trends emphasizing convenience and efficiency.
